加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zz.com.cn/)- 语音技术、视频终端、数据开发、人脸识别、智能机器人!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

Asp进阶攻略:技术架构实战全解析

发布时间:2026-04-09 16:59:37 所属栏目:Asp教程 来源:DaWei
导读:  Asp进阶攻略的核心在于理解其技术架构的底层逻辑,以及如何在实际项目中高效应用。Asp(Active Server Pages)作为一种早期的服务器端脚本技术,虽然在现代开发中逐渐被更先进的框架所取代,但其设计理念和实现方

  Asp进阶攻略的核心在于理解其技术架构的底层逻辑,以及如何在实际项目中高效应用。Asp(Active Server Pages)作为一种早期的服务器端脚本技术,虽然在现代开发中逐渐被更先进的框架所取代,但其设计理念和实现方式仍然具有重要的参考价值。


  在构建Asp应用时,合理的分层架构能够显著提升代码的可维护性和扩展性。通常,可以将系统分为表现层、业务逻辑层和数据访问层。表现层负责与用户交互,业务逻辑层处理核心功能,而数据访问层则专注于数据库操作。


  在Asp中,使用组件化开发是提高代码复用性的关键。通过创建自定义组件,可以将常用功能封装为独立模块,减少重复代码,并便于后期维护。例如,可以将数据库连接、用户验证等通用功能抽象为组件。


  性能优化也是Asp项目中不可忽视的部分。合理使用缓存机制、减少不必要的数据库查询、优化脚本执行流程,都能有效提升系统响应速度。同时,避免在页面中直接嵌入复杂逻辑,有助于降低资源消耗。


  安全问题在任何Web开发中都至关重要。Asp应用需要防范SQL注入、XSS攻击等常见威胁,可以通过输入验证、参数化查询和输出编码等方式进行防护。对敏感信息如数据库密码应进行加密存储。


AI生成结论图,仅供参考

  随着技术的发展,Asp的局限性逐渐显现。但在一些遗留系统或特定场景下,它依然有其存在的价值。掌握Asp的技术架构,不仅有助于理解历史技术演进,也为学习现代框架提供了良好的基础。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章